2-BROMOCINNAMALDEHYDE Chemical Properties

Boiling point:
305.8±17.0 °C(Predicted)
Density 
1.466±0.06 g/cm3(Predicted)
storage temp. 
Inert atmosphere,Store in freezer, under -20°C
Appearance
Light yellow to yellow Solid

2-BROMOCINNAMALDEHYDE Usage And Synthesis

Synthesis

2136-75-6

6630-33-7

138555-58-5

General method: To a 10 mL solution of (formylmethylene)triphenylphosphine (1.5 mmol) in solvent (CH2Cl2 or THF) was added slowly and dropwise to a 4 mL solution of o-bromobenzaldehyde (1.0 mmol) in solvent (CH2Cl2 or THF) at 0 °C under argon protection. The reaction mixture was warmed to 25 °C with continuous stirring until the reaction was complete, and the progress of the reaction was monitored by thin layer chromatography (TLC). Upon completion of the reaction, the solvent was removed by concentration under reduced pressure to give the crude product. The crude product was purified by column chromatography on silica gel (60-120 mesh), with a mixed solvent of petroleum ether/ethyl acetate as eluent, to finally obtain the target product (E)-3-(2-bromophenyl)acrolein.
